Modern car keys aren't the basic metal pieces that you can cut at the kiosks in malls. They contain a complex piece of electronical equipment called the transponder chip, which needs to be programmed to function with your specific vehicle's security system. key fob programing near me of locksmiths for cars can handle this job, so it is recommended to let them handle it.
If your car is equipped with an immobilizer, you will need a special key that contains an embedded transponder chip to activate it. This kind of key is required by most owners of cars to disable their car's anti-theft system, which became mandatory in 1995. Most locksmiths are able to quickly copy and program these keys, but you will need to call them outside of their normal hours of operation.

If you have a leased vehicle, make sure you check your policy documents before having a new key fob programmed. The lease may require that you visit the dealership to have the new key programmed, or even prohibit it. This will help you avoid making costly mistakes that could lead to the termination of your lease.
